Manufacturer and Distributor of Automotive Service Supplies
$ 285,000
CF : $ 121,616
For over 55 years this company manufactured and distributed a complete assortment of automotive related products. Their products are sold to wholesalers, service and repair shops, and the sales, parts and service departments of car dealerships across the U.S. I’m sure you’ve seen their gear used at your local repair shop. The business serves both its wholesale and retail customers. From their wholesalers, the business receives orders from purchasing agents when inventory runs low or to fulfill a custom order; most orders are shipped within 24 hours. For the auto dealers and repair shops, they receive orders directly on their website, via phone calls, or via email when the customer's product inventories are low. Most products are consumables and enjoy a predictable reorder rate. The business is recession resistant: a working car is essential. Established Franchise Food Prep Business
$ 50,000
This is a meal prep franchise specializing in quick and easy dinners designed with families in mind. This location is in an affluent part of the South Bay Area, California. Families get meals in three different ways. They can order online, selecting from a monthly menu of entrees. The team will prep, portion, and bag the meals, ready for the family to refrigerate or freeze. Alternatively, people can come into the store, and prep the meals themselves onsite, which allows for greater customization. Lastly, they can order meals to be delivered. Dream Dinners is a great place to gather and prep meals with neighborhood friends. The recipes are wide-ranging, with options that cook in under 30 minutes and no-mess pan meals that go straight in the oven. Each recipe includes easy-to-follow cooking instructions to make things simple. The owners each have full-time jobs and have been running this as a side business since day one.
